Lebanon reports 486 killed, 1,313 wounded since Israeli attacks began on March 2

Lebanon’s health ministry said at least 486 people have been killed and 1,313 wounded since Israeli attacks began on 2 March. An Israeli drone targeted a car in the southern town of Burj Rahal. Another strike hit the town of Srifa. Israeli air attacks also struck several other areas in southern Lebanon, including Arab Salim, Barghaz and Majdal Selm. Meanwhile, projectiles were launched from southern Lebanon towards Israel.
